Baltic-style porters were that region's interpretation of the Imperial Stouts - the very strong, dense beers commissioned from London by Catherine the Great, Empress of Russia. The Baltic brewers made their version at low temperatures using lager yeasts and locally available ingredients. As have we. The result is rich and dense yet with a creamy lightness. The aromas given off are dark chocolate, butterscotch, and freshly brewed coffee. The beer has a warming character on the palate, leading to fig jam and apple treacle flavours and finishing with a pleasant bitterness. For a beer of this strength, there is a surprisingly thirst-quenching mouthfeel and drinkability.
Food Pairing Suggestions: Oysters, smoked fish with a good butter and nice brown bread; hearty stews of slow-cooked dark meats; sticky toffee pudding, chocolate tart with sour cream; cheeses - particularly smoked cheese or creamy, washed rind cheeses
